Skip to content

Instantly share code, notes, and snippets.

@WasabiFan
Created September 9, 2019 23:57
Show Gist options
  • Save WasabiFan/03a2c26ff41dc8141830abe5b7dd3ee7 to your computer and use it in GitHub Desktop.
Save WasabiFan/03a2c26ff41dc8141830abe5b7dd3ee7 to your computer and use it in GitHub Desktop.
--- ../pre-clean.txt 2019-09-09 16:53:41.723616000 -0700
+++ ../post-clean.txt 2019-09-09 16:53:55.114634800 -0700
@@ -1,26 +1,11 @@
.
./ext
./ext/cmsis
-./ext/cmsis/core
-./ext/cmsis/core/cmsis_compiler.h
-./ext/cmsis/core/cmsis_gcc.h
-./ext/cmsis/core/cmsis_version.h
-./ext/cmsis/core/core_cm4.h
-./ext/cmsis/core/mpu_armv7.h
./ext/cmsis/device
-./ext/cmsis/device/stm32f429xx.h
./ext/cmsis/device/stm32f469xx.h
-./ext/cmsis/device/system_stm32f4xx.h
./ext/dlr
./ext/dlr/scons
./ext/dlr/scons/site_tools
-./ext/dlr/scons/site_tools/compiler_arm_none_eabi_gcc.py
-./ext/dlr/scons/site_tools/settings_buildpath.py
-./ext/dlr/scons/site_tools/settings_gcc_default_internal.py
-./ext/dlr/scons/site_tools/utils_buildformat.py
-./ext/dlr/scons/site_tools/utils_buildsize.py
-./ext/dlr/scons/site_tools/utils_common.py
-./ext/dlr/scons/site_tools/utils_gcc_version.py
./ext/dlr/scons/site_tools/__pycache__
./ext/dlr/scons/site_tools/__pycache__/compiler_arm_none_eabi_gcc.cpython-37.pyc
./ext/dlr/scons/site_tools/__pycache__/settings_buildpath.cpython-37.pyc
@@ -29,34 +14,11 @@
./ext/dlr/scons/site_tools/__pycache__/utils_buildsize.cpython-37.pyc
./ext/dlr/scons/site_tools/__pycache__/utils_common.cpython-37.pyc
./ext/dlr/scons/site_tools/__pycache__/utils_gcc_version.cpython-37.pyc
-./ext/printf
-./ext/printf/printf.h
-./ext/printf/printf.source
./ext/tlsf
./ext/tlsf/tlsf.c
./ext/tlsf/tlsf.h
-./gdbinit
-./link
-./link/linkerscript.ld
-./openocd.cfg
-./openocd_gdbinit
./scons
./scons/site_tools
-./scons/site_tools/artifact.py
-./scons/site_tools/black_magic_probe.py
-./scons/site_tools/build_target.py
-./scons/site_tools/find_files.py
-./scons/site_tools/gdb.py
-./scons/site_tools/log_itm.py
-./scons/site_tools/postmortem_gdb.py
-./scons/site_tools/program_openocd.py
-./scons/site_tools/qtcreator
-./scons/site_tools/qtcreator/project.config.in
-./scons/site_tools/qtcreator/project.creator.in
-./scons/site_tools/qtcreator/project.files.in
-./scons/site_tools/qtcreator/project.includes.in
-./scons/site_tools/qtcreator.py
-./scons/site_tools/template.py
./scons/site_tools/__pycache__
./scons/site_tools/__pycache__/artifact.cpython-37.pyc
./scons/site_tools/__pycache__/black_magic_probe.cpython-37.pyc
@@ -68,55 +30,18 @@
./scons/site_tools/__pycache__/program_openocd.cpython-37.pyc
./scons/site_tools/__pycache__/qtcreator.cpython-37.pyc
./scons/site_tools/__pycache__/template.cpython-37.pyc
-./SConscript
./src
./src/modm
./src/modm/architecture
-./src/modm/architecture/detect.hpp
-./src/modm/architecture/driver
-./src/modm/architecture/driver/atomic
-./src/modm/architecture/driver/atomic/container.hpp
-./src/modm/architecture/driver/atomic/flag.cpp
-./src/modm/architecture/driver/atomic/flag.hpp
-./src/modm/architecture/driver/atomic/queue.hpp
-./src/modm/architecture/driver/atomic/queue_impl.hpp
-./src/modm/architecture/driver/atomic.hpp
./src/modm/architecture/interface
-./src/modm/architecture/interface/accessor.hpp
-./src/modm/architecture/interface/accessor_flash.hpp
-./src/modm/architecture/interface/accessor_ram.hpp
-./src/modm/architecture/interface/assert.h
-./src/modm/architecture/interface/assert.hpp
-./src/modm/architecture/interface/atomic_lock.hpp
-./src/modm/architecture/interface/clock.hpp
-./src/modm/architecture/interface/delay.hpp
-./src/modm/architecture/interface/gpio.hpp
-./src/modm/architecture/interface/i2c.cpp
-./src/modm/architecture/interface/i2c.hpp
-./src/modm/architecture/interface/i2c_device.hpp
-./src/modm/architecture/interface/i2c_master.hpp
-./src/modm/architecture/interface/i2c_transaction.hpp
-./src/modm/architecture/interface/interrupt.hpp
-./src/modm/architecture/interface/memory.hpp
-./src/modm/architecture/interface/peripheral.hpp
-./src/modm/architecture/interface/register.hpp
-./src/modm/architecture/interface/spi.hpp
-./src/modm/architecture/interface/spi_device.hpp
-./src/modm/architecture/interface/spi_master.hpp
./src/modm/architecture/interface/uart.hpp
-./src/modm/architecture/interface.hpp
-./src/modm/architecture/utils.hpp
-./src/modm/architecture.hpp
./src/modm/board
-./src/modm/board/board.cpp
-./src/modm/board/board.hpp
./src/modm/board/board_display.cpp
./src/modm/board/board_dsi.cpp
./src/modm/board/board_init.cpp
./src/modm/board/board_otm8009a.cpp
./src/modm/board/board_sdram.cpp
./src/modm/board/module.md
-./src/modm/board.hpp
./src/modm/container
./src/modm/container/deque.hpp
./src/modm/container/deque_impl.hpp
@@ -157,22 +82,9 @@
./src/modm/debug/module.md
./src/modm/debug.hpp
./src/modm/driver
-./src/modm/driver/inertial
-./src/modm/driver/inertial/l3gd20.hpp
-./src/modm/driver/inertial/l3gd20_impl.hpp
-./src/modm/driver/inertial/lis3_transport.hpp
-./src/modm/driver/inertial/lis3_transport_impl.hpp
./src/modm/driver/touch
./src/modm/driver/touch/ft6x06.hpp
./src/modm/driver/touch/ft6x06_impl.hpp
-./src/modm/io
-./src/modm/io/iodevice.hpp
-./src/modm/io/iodevice_wrapper.hpp
-./src/modm/io/iostream.cpp
-./src/modm/io/iostream.hpp
-./src/modm/io/iostream_printf.cpp
-./src/modm/io/module.md
-./src/modm/io.hpp
./src/modm/math
./src/modm/math/geometry
./src/modm/math/geometry/angle.cpp
@@ -210,168 +122,10 @@
./src/modm/math/lu_decomposition_impl.hpp
./src/modm/math/matrix.hpp
./src/modm/math/matrix_impl.hpp
-./src/modm/math/tolerance.hpp
-./src/modm/math/units.hpp
-./src/modm/math/utils
-./src/modm/math/utils/arithmetic_traits.hpp
-./src/modm/math/utils/bit_constants.hpp
-./src/modm/math/utils/bit_operation.cpp
-./src/modm/math/utils/bit_operation.hpp
-./src/modm/math/utils/crc32.hpp
-./src/modm/math/utils/endianness.hpp
-./src/modm/math/utils/misc.hpp
-./src/modm/math/utils/operator.hpp
-./src/modm/math/utils/operator_impl.hpp
-./src/modm/math/utils/pc
-./src/modm/math/utils/pc/operator.cpp
-./src/modm/math/utils.hpp
-./src/modm/math.hpp
./src/modm/platform
-./src/modm/platform/clock
-./src/modm/platform/clock/common.hpp
-./src/modm/platform/clock/rcc.cpp
-./src/modm/platform/clock/rcc.hpp
-./src/modm/platform/clock/rcc_impl.hpp
-./src/modm/platform/clock/systick_timer.cpp
-./src/modm/platform/clock/systick_timer.hpp
./src/modm/platform/core
-./src/modm/platform/core/assert.cpp
-./src/modm/platform/core/atomic_lock.hpp
-./src/modm/platform/core/clock.cpp
-./src/modm/platform/core/cxxabi.cpp
-./src/modm/platform/core/delay.cpp
-./src/modm/platform/core/delay.hpp
-./src/modm/platform/core/flash_reader.hpp
-./src/modm/platform/core/hardware_init.hpp
-./src/modm/platform/core/heap_newlib.cpp
-./src/modm/platform/core/heap_table.cpp
-./src/modm/platform/core/heap_table.hpp
./src/modm/platform/core/heap_tlsf.cpp
-./src/modm/platform/core/peripherals.hpp
-./src/modm/platform/core/reset_handler.sx
-./src/modm/platform/core/startup.c
-./src/modm/platform/core/startup_platform.c
-./src/modm/platform/core/vectors.c
-./src/modm/platform/device.hpp
./src/modm/platform/gpio
-./src/modm/platform/gpio/base.hpp
-./src/modm/platform/gpio/connector.hpp
-./src/modm/platform/gpio/connector_detail.hpp
-./src/modm/platform/gpio/enable.cpp
-./src/modm/platform/gpio/gpio_A0.hpp
-./src/modm/platform/gpio/gpio_A1.hpp
-./src/modm/platform/gpio/gpio_A10.hpp
-./src/modm/platform/gpio/gpio_A11.hpp
-./src/modm/platform/gpio/gpio_A12.hpp
-./src/modm/platform/gpio/gpio_A13.hpp
-./src/modm/platform/gpio/gpio_A14.hpp
-./src/modm/platform/gpio/gpio_A15.hpp
-./src/modm/platform/gpio/gpio_A2.hpp
-./src/modm/platform/gpio/gpio_A3.hpp
-./src/modm/platform/gpio/gpio_A4.hpp
-./src/modm/platform/gpio/gpio_A5.hpp
-./src/modm/platform/gpio/gpio_A6.hpp
-./src/modm/platform/gpio/gpio_A7.hpp
-./src/modm/platform/gpio/gpio_A8.hpp
-./src/modm/platform/gpio/gpio_A9.hpp
-./src/modm/platform/gpio/gpio_B0.hpp
-./src/modm/platform/gpio/gpio_B1.hpp
-./src/modm/platform/gpio/gpio_B10.hpp
-./src/modm/platform/gpio/gpio_B11.hpp
-./src/modm/platform/gpio/gpio_B12.hpp
-./src/modm/platform/gpio/gpio_B13.hpp
-./src/modm/platform/gpio/gpio_B14.hpp
-./src/modm/platform/gpio/gpio_B15.hpp
-./src/modm/platform/gpio/gpio_B2.hpp
-./src/modm/platform/gpio/gpio_B3.hpp
-./src/modm/platform/gpio/gpio_B4.hpp
-./src/modm/platform/gpio/gpio_B5.hpp
-./src/modm/platform/gpio/gpio_B6.hpp
-./src/modm/platform/gpio/gpio_B7.hpp
-./src/modm/platform/gpio/gpio_B8.hpp
-./src/modm/platform/gpio/gpio_B9.hpp
-./src/modm/platform/gpio/gpio_C0.hpp
-./src/modm/platform/gpio/gpio_C1.hpp
-./src/modm/platform/gpio/gpio_C10.hpp
-./src/modm/platform/gpio/gpio_C11.hpp
-./src/modm/platform/gpio/gpio_C12.hpp
-./src/modm/platform/gpio/gpio_C13.hpp
-./src/modm/platform/gpio/gpio_C14.hpp
-./src/modm/platform/gpio/gpio_C15.hpp
-./src/modm/platform/gpio/gpio_C2.hpp
-./src/modm/platform/gpio/gpio_C3.hpp
-./src/modm/platform/gpio/gpio_C4.hpp
-./src/modm/platform/gpio/gpio_C5.hpp
-./src/modm/platform/gpio/gpio_C6.hpp
-./src/modm/platform/gpio/gpio_C7.hpp
-./src/modm/platform/gpio/gpio_C8.hpp
-./src/modm/platform/gpio/gpio_C9.hpp
-./src/modm/platform/gpio/gpio_D0.hpp
-./src/modm/platform/gpio/gpio_D1.hpp
-./src/modm/platform/gpio/gpio_D10.hpp
-./src/modm/platform/gpio/gpio_D11.hpp
-./src/modm/platform/gpio/gpio_D12.hpp
-./src/modm/platform/gpio/gpio_D13.hpp
-./src/modm/platform/gpio/gpio_D14.hpp
-./src/modm/platform/gpio/gpio_D15.hpp
-./src/modm/platform/gpio/gpio_D2.hpp
-./src/modm/platform/gpio/gpio_D3.hpp
-./src/modm/platform/gpio/gpio_D4.hpp
-./src/modm/platform/gpio/gpio_D5.hpp
-./src/modm/platform/gpio/gpio_D6.hpp
-./src/modm/platform/gpio/gpio_D7.hpp
-./src/modm/platform/gpio/gpio_D8.hpp
-./src/modm/platform/gpio/gpio_D9.hpp
-./src/modm/platform/gpio/gpio_E0.hpp
-./src/modm/platform/gpio/gpio_E1.hpp
-./src/modm/platform/gpio/gpio_E10.hpp
-./src/modm/platform/gpio/gpio_E11.hpp
-./src/modm/platform/gpio/gpio_E12.hpp
-./src/modm/platform/gpio/gpio_E13.hpp
-./src/modm/platform/gpio/gpio_E14.hpp
-./src/modm/platform/gpio/gpio_E15.hpp
-./src/modm/platform/gpio/gpio_E2.hpp
-./src/modm/platform/gpio/gpio_E3.hpp
-./src/modm/platform/gpio/gpio_E4.hpp
-./src/modm/platform/gpio/gpio_E5.hpp
-./src/modm/platform/gpio/gpio_E6.hpp
-./src/modm/platform/gpio/gpio_E7.hpp
-./src/modm/platform/gpio/gpio_E8.hpp
-./src/modm/platform/gpio/gpio_E9.hpp
-./src/modm/platform/gpio/gpio_F0.hpp
-./src/modm/platform/gpio/gpio_F1.hpp
-./src/modm/platform/gpio/gpio_F10.hpp
-./src/modm/platform/gpio/gpio_F11.hpp
-./src/modm/platform/gpio/gpio_F12.hpp
-./src/modm/platform/gpio/gpio_F13.hpp
-./src/modm/platform/gpio/gpio_F14.hpp
-./src/modm/platform/gpio/gpio_F15.hpp
-./src/modm/platform/gpio/gpio_F2.hpp
-./src/modm/platform/gpio/gpio_F3.hpp
-./src/modm/platform/gpio/gpio_F4.hpp
-./src/modm/platform/gpio/gpio_F5.hpp
-./src/modm/platform/gpio/gpio_F6.hpp
-./src/modm/platform/gpio/gpio_F7.hpp
-./src/modm/platform/gpio/gpio_F8.hpp
-./src/modm/platform/gpio/gpio_F9.hpp
-./src/modm/platform/gpio/gpio_G0.hpp
-./src/modm/platform/gpio/gpio_G1.hpp
-./src/modm/platform/gpio/gpio_G10.hpp
-./src/modm/platform/gpio/gpio_G11.hpp
-./src/modm/platform/gpio/gpio_G12.hpp
-./src/modm/platform/gpio/gpio_G13.hpp
-./src/modm/platform/gpio/gpio_G14.hpp
-./src/modm/platform/gpio/gpio_G15.hpp
-./src/modm/platform/gpio/gpio_G2.hpp
-./src/modm/platform/gpio/gpio_G3.hpp
-./src/modm/platform/gpio/gpio_G4.hpp
-./src/modm/platform/gpio/gpio_G5.hpp
-./src/modm/platform/gpio/gpio_G6.hpp
-./src/modm/platform/gpio/gpio_G7.hpp
-./src/modm/platform/gpio/gpio_G8.hpp
-./src/modm/platform/gpio/gpio_G9.hpp
-./src/modm/platform/gpio/gpio_H0.hpp
-./src/modm/platform/gpio/gpio_H1.hpp
./src/modm/platform/gpio/gpio_H10.hpp
./src/modm/platform/gpio/gpio_H11.hpp
./src/modm/platform/gpio/gpio_H12.hpp
@@ -417,20 +171,9 @@
./src/modm/platform/gpio/gpio_K5.hpp
./src/modm/platform/gpio/gpio_K6.hpp
./src/modm/platform/gpio/gpio_K7.hpp
-./src/modm/platform/gpio/inverted.hpp
-./src/modm/platform/gpio/port.hpp
-./src/modm/platform/gpio/set.hpp
-./src/modm/platform/gpio/software_port.hpp
-./src/modm/platform/gpio/unused.hpp
./src/modm/platform/i2c
./src/modm/platform/i2c/i2c_master_1.cpp
./src/modm/platform/i2c/i2c_master_1.hpp
-./src/modm/platform/spi
-./src/modm/platform/spi/spi_base.hpp
-./src/modm/platform/spi/spi_hal_5.hpp
-./src/modm/platform/spi/spi_hal_5_impl.hpp
-./src/modm/platform/spi/spi_master_5.cpp
-./src/modm/platform/spi/spi_master_5.hpp
./src/modm/platform/uart
./src/modm/platform/uart/uart_3.cpp
./src/modm/platform/uart/uart_3.hpp
@@ -438,23 +181,6 @@
./src/modm/platform/uart/uart_baudrate.hpp
./src/modm/platform/uart/uart_hal_3.hpp
./src/modm/platform/uart/uart_hal_3_impl.hpp
-./src/modm/platform.hpp
-./src/modm/processing
-./src/modm/processing/resumable
-./src/modm/processing/resumable/macros.hpp
-./src/modm/processing/resumable/nested_resumable.hpp
-./src/modm/processing/resumable/resumable.hpp
-./src/modm/processing/resumable.hpp
-./src/modm/processing/task.hpp
-./src/modm/processing/timer
-./src/modm/processing/timer/module.md
-./src/modm/processing/timer/periodic_timer.hpp
-./src/modm/processing/timer/periodic_timer_impl.hpp
-./src/modm/processing/timer/timeout.hpp
-./src/modm/processing/timer/timeout_impl.hpp
-./src/modm/processing/timer/timestamp.hpp
-./src/modm/processing/timer.hpp
-./src/modm/processing.hpp
./src/modm/ui
./src/modm/ui/display
./src/modm/ui/display/character_display.cpp
@@ -504,13 +230,3 @@
./src/modm/ui/display/virtual_graphic_display.cpp
./src/modm/ui/display/virtual_graphic_display.hpp
./src/modm/ui/display.hpp
-./src/modm/utils
-./src/modm/utils/allocator
-./src/modm/utils/allocator/allocator_base.hpp
-./src/modm/utils/allocator/block.hpp
-./src/modm/utils/allocator/dynamic.hpp
-./src/modm/utils/allocator/static.hpp
-./src/modm/utils/allocator.hpp
-./src/modm/utils/dummy.cpp
-./src/modm/utils/dummy.hpp
-./src/modm/utils.hpp
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ment